From 1 January 2021 Prof. Michelle Pace became an Associate Fellow at Chatham House’s Europe Programme. Prof. Michelle Pace provides analysis on the EU and its southern neighbourhood, European approaches to the Middle East and North Africa/Mediterranean, as well as migration issues. Emre Iseri and Cengiz Mert Bulut published a chapter entitled “Türk Dış Politikası ve Orta Doğu: Güç, çıkar, kimlik ve değerler sarmalında Türkiye’nin önündeki fırsatlar ve zorluklar” (Turkish Foreign Policy and Middle East: Spiral of power, interests, identity and values) in Tarık Oğuzlu and Yelda Demirağ (ed.), Kuramlar ve Olgular: Türk Dış Politikasına Uluslararası İlişkiler Teorileri penceresinden bakmak (Theories and Facts: Looking at the Turkish Foreign Policy through International Relations Theories), Nobel Yayın (with Cengiz Mert Bulut), 2019.
